Walnut Hill has a population of 112. 47.3% of Walnut Hill’s inhabitants are Male, and 52.7 are female. 48.9% of Walnut Hill is married and 73.2% own their own home. The Average Home price is $49,500. Household median income in Walnut Hill is $32,917, and the individual median income is $27,500. Walnut Hill’s Ethnic is the following: White(90.2%), Multiple(9.8%).


In the early 19th century, William Goings (also spelled Goins) kept a tavern that was presumably on land homesteaded by Goings about two miles south of Walnut Hill in Jefferson County, Illinois. William Goings lead a band of robbers known as the "Goings Gang" that preyed on frontier travelers on the Vincennes-St.


Louis Trace, a dirt road that was originally an old bison path that extended through southern Illinois. The gang operated a series of connected frontier taverns along this road, passing information on to gang members whenever a traveler worth robbing stopped at one of their taverns. When the unfortunate traveler reached a remote spot, the gang members would assemble and relieve them of their property. As in other frontier areas, neighboring settlers overlooked this activity until the Goings Gang escalated to murder in 1818–1819.


In response, the settlers organized a group of vigilantes or "rangers" who surprised the Goings Gang at Walnut Hill. The gang members were tied to trees, flogged, and ordered to leave the county, an order which all but one obeyed. The following year, the vigilantes returned and cropped the ears of this obstinate gang member, who may have been criminal gang leader William Goings, possibly because they believed he had no use for his ears as he would not listen and cease in his criminal activities.


The tavern site of one of the reported gang members, Samuel Young of Marion County, Illinois was excavated by archaeologists working for the Illinois Department of Transportation in 1988 prior to its destruction by a highway project
